The holidays are starting early this year as the Season of Xbox will begin on November 2, when Xbox One will be available for a special, limited-time promotional offer of $349 in the U.S. Special promotional pricing of $50 off the console of your choice applies to any Xbox One console, including special edition bundles, offering some of the year’s most anticipated games - Assassin’s Creed: Unity, Call of Duty: Advanced Warfare and Sunset Overdrive. With Xbox One available at its best price yet, and savings up to $150 off select bundles, there’s never been a better time to own an Xbox One.
 
*$50 off any Xbox One console or bundle. Offer valid November 2, 2014 through January 3, 2015 at participating retailers.

I have a Mover's Coupon (new one that doesn't have an online code). There shouldn't be an issue holding one for in store pickup and then using the coupon when I pick it up right? Just not too familiar how these coupons work.

 
Last edited by a moderator:
it won't work straight up easy.  an online order for instore pickup is handled differently than regular store checkout, you go to a special online pickup section and there is no registry stuff, they just mark your order as picked up and the bestbuy.com system handles payment - you aren't checking out with a regular register.

you'd have to go in store, tell them you have a coupon, basically cancel the online order (losing any RZ certs coupons etc you have applied), have them "return" the product, and then walk the console over to regular checkout.  Or have a manager mosy over and check you out.  Or something new and different since every week Best Buy changes things.

Also some people have had problems with the movers coupon working during checkout (in store) for console bundles, for others its worked just fine.

So yeah sorry nothing really definitive but anytime you involve the movers coupon and/or online pickup it turns into a possible messy situation.
